What is the normal timeline for an accident case?
The timeline can vary significantly depending on case complexity, the cooperation of insurance companies, and whether the case goes to trial. Some cases can settle in months, while others may take years.
Just how much does it cost to work with an accident attorney?
Most Accident Injury Attorney attorneys operate on a contingency cost basis, meaning they only make money if you win. Costs normally range from 25% to 40% of the settlement.
What if my accident was partly my fault?
In numerous states, you can still recuperate damages even if you were partially at fault. Nevertheless, your compensation might be minimized based upon your portion of fault.
